Inclusion criteria

Inclusion criteria: The duration of illness will range from to six months to one year. • Patients 's age will range from 45 to 55 years. • The muscle tone of ankle planter flexors will range from 1+ to 2 according to Modified Ashworth Scale. • They will have sufficient cognition demonstrating to understand the requirements of the study. • All patients will be medically and psychologically stable.

Exclusion criteria

Exclusion criteria: Patients who had a cognitive impairment • Patients who had other neurological disorders affecting gait ability. • Patients who had other orthopedic disorders affecting gait ability. • Patients had deformities of lower limb especially ankle. • Patients had impairment of deep sensation. • Patients had visual and perceptual dysfunctions.

Design outcomes

Primary

MeasureTime frame
Gait spatio-temporal parameters using Biodex gait trainer ;H M ratio by nerve conduction study

Secondary

MeasureTime frame
Balance by Berg balance scale ;Morse fall scale for assessment of risk of fall ;10 meter walk test to assess speed of walking
